
Silent Hill 2 developer Bloober Team has confirmed in a statement that it's still working with Konami on delivering a true PS5 Pro enhancement update for its excellent survival horror remake. Via Eurogamer, it simply said: "We're working with the publisher on a solution and will share more details as soon as we have them."
Around the time of the PS5 Pro's release late last year, Silent Hill 2 was tagged as a PS5 Pro Enhanced game. However, no such update actually arrived, and then it turned out the PS5 version actually ran worse when played on a PS5 Pro. A noticeable "shimmering" effect was discovered by players, and was ever-present on PS5 Pro, becoming a distraction as you played.

Bloober Team has been aware of the technical issues since November 2024, and patches since then have not delivered the advertised PS5 Pro upgrades. Breaking its silence six months later, Bloober Team confirms the problems continue to be looked at.
